Delinquent tax attorney briefs board on collection efforts

Waller ISD Board of Trustees · April 9, 2026
AI-Generated Content: All content on this page was generated by AI to highlight key points from the meeting. For complete details and context, we recommend watching the full video. so we can fix them.

Summary

Perdue Brandon Fielder Collins Mott attorney Otilia Gonzales updated trustees on the district’s delinquent tax balances and described the firm’s ongoing recovery efforts for prior tax years.

Attorney Otilia Gonzales of Perdue Brandon Fielder Collins Mott provided a brief report to the board on delinquent property tax collections owed to Waller ISD. Gonzales presented a breakdown of outstanding balances by prior tax years and summarized the law firm’s efforts to recover those balances on the district’s behalf.

The minutes record the presentation as informational; there were no motions or board actions tied directly to the delinquent tax report at the April 9 meeting. The legal firm will continue recovery efforts under the firm’s existing engagement with the district and provide updates as collections progress.
